Guthrie Castle

Built by Sir David Guthrie in 1468, the original square keep consisted of three stories and a garret. The castle was abandoned in about 1760 and a new house built nearby. In 1848 the house and castle were linked by a panelled Great Hall.

The grounds include a loch, horseshoe-shaped walled garden, 160 year old yew hedges shaped as a Celtic Cross, and a golf course.
